1:for,while,dowhile,switch的使用同java。值得小心的是对于布尔类型的判定与java存在区别。
2:break,continue的用法也同java。只是需要注意的是break和continue后面可以跟上数字,表示跳出几层循环,或者是终止几层循环当前的循环,进行下一个值的循环。
3:goto语句在java中已经被废除。在php的5.3版本以后还是存在的。它可以跳出所有的循环或者处理,去到某个指定的位置进行执行。这个不太推荐使用,使用的话,要注意在同一个文件或作用域内使用。
4:常量,对于常量来说,名字格式同java,都是大写,字母间用下划线,一旦定义赋值后不能够修改,取消定义。前面都不需要$符号等。但是还有属于php自身的东西。
.用define和const都是可以定义的。
.只适用于基本数据类型(int,string,float,double,boolean)
本文深入探讨了PHP中的循环结构(for, while, do-while)、条件语句(switch)、跳转语句(break, continue)以及常量定义等关键特性。同时指出PHP在循环控制上的独特之处,如break和continue后的数字使用方法。强调goto语句已被废弃,仅在某些版本中保留。此外,文章详细解释了PHP中常量的定义方式和使用注意事项。

1916

被折叠的 条评论
为什么被折叠?



